How to Advertise Plumbing Business Through Local SEO Strategies
Local SEO is key for plumbers to succeed online. It helps you reach customers nearby who need plumbing help fast. By using local SEO, you can get more people to find and contact you.
Good local SEO means more than just marketing. You need a strong online presence that fits your local area well.
Optimizing Your Google Business Profile
Your Google Business Profile is like your online store. A good profile can make you more visible in local searches. Here’s how to make it better:
- Verify your business location
- Define all service areas accurately
- Select primary and secondary business categories
- Upload high-quality professional photos
- Post weekly updates about services and offers
- Respond to customer reviews promptly
Local Keyword Targeting and Implementation
For plumbers, using the right local keywords is important. Use phrases like:
- “Emergency plumber in [Your City]”
- “Water heater repair [Your Neighborhood]”
- “Residential plumbing services near me”
Use tools like Google Keyword Planner and Ubersuggest to find good keywords. Look for ones that people search for a lot but aren’t too competitive.
NAP Consistency Across Online Directories
It’s important to keep your Name, Address, and Phone (NAP) the same everywhere online. If they’re different, it can confuse search engines and hurt your ranking.
| Directory | Importance | Verification Status |
|---|---|---|
| Google Business Profile | Critical | Verified |
| Yelp | High | Verified |
| HomeAdvisor | Medium | Verified |
| Better Business Bureau | High | Verified |
Pro Tip: You should see better rankings in 30-60 days after using these local SEO tips for your plumbing business.

Leveraging Pay-Per-Click Advertising for Immediate Lead Generation
Pay-per-click (PPC) advertising is a strong tool for plumbing businesses. It gives you quick visibility in digital marketing. Unlike organic SEO, which takes months, PPC ads can put you at the top of search results right away.
When using PPC for your plumbing business, keep these key strategies in mind:
- Create separate campaigns for each major service
- Use radius targeting around your service area
- Set dayparting to show ads during business hours
- Add call extensions for direct customer contact
Pro tip: Your ad copy should include urgent language like “24/7” and “Same-Day Service” to attract ready-to-act customers.
“PPC advertising allows plumbers to compete instantly in a crowded digital marketplace.” – Digital Marketing Experts
Budgets for plumbing services digital ads vary. Competitive keywords can cost between $15-$50 per click. Conversion rates are usually 5-10%. Local Services Ads offer a different way, where you pay per lead, not per click.
Start with a daily budget of $30-$50. Run campaigns for at least 30 days before making big changes. Watch your results closely to improve your ad strategy and get more leads.
Building a Powerful Online Reputation Through Customer Reviews
Your online reputation is key in today’s digital world. Customer reviews are vital, with almost 93% of people reading them before choosing a service. A good review profile can greatly improve your visibility and trustworthiness.

Effective local plumbing marketing strategies need a solid plan for managing customer feedback. It’s important to have a consistent and professional way to collect and respond to reviews on different platforms.
Creating a Systematic Review Request Process
Here’s how to get more positive reviews:
- Ask for reviews right after you finish a job
- Send easy-to-use review links via text or email
- Train your team to ask for reviews in person
- Try to get 3-5 new reviews each month
Professional Review Management Techniques
Managing your online reputation needs a proactive and professional strategy. Here’s how to handle customer reviews:
| Review Type | Response Strategy | Timeframe |
|---|---|---|
| Positive Reviews | Thank the customer personally | Within 24 hours |
| Negative Reviews | Apologize and offer a solution | Within 24 hours |
Focus on important platforms for your local plumbing marketing:
- Google Business Profile
- Yelp
- Industry-specific sites like Angi
Pro tip: Never pay for reviews or fake positive feedback. Real, honest reviews are what build trust with future customers.

Email Marketing and Customer Retention Strategies

Email marketing is a cost-effective way for plumbers to get a great return on investment. It helps keep in touch with past customers and grow new leads.
To start with email marketing, build a genuine list of subscribers. You can get email addresses by:
- Adding email fields to service completion forms
- Offering downloadable maintenance guides on your website
- Creating pop-ups with seasonal plumbing tips
- Collecting contacts during community events
Creating engaging email content is key. Use platforms like Mailchimp to make your campaigns better and track their success.
| Email Campaign Type | Purpose | Frequency |
|---|---|---|
| Welcome Series | Introduce business and services | First 2 weeks of subscription |
| Seasonal Maintenance | Generate service calls | Quarterly |
| Re-engagement | Reconnect with past customers | Every 6 months |
Your marketing should focus on adding value, not just selling. Aim for 70% educational and 30% promotional content. Keep an eye on metrics like open rates and click-through rates to improve your emails.
Remember: Email marketing delivers an impressive $36 return for every dollar spent, making it a powerful tool for plumbing businesses.
Traditional Advertising Methods That Stil Work Today
Digital marketing is big today, but old-school ads are not forgotten. Smart plumbers mix digital and traditional ads for the best results. This combo boosts local visibility and reaches more customers.
There are many ways to make your plumbing business shine with traditional ads. These methods work well when used smartly with digital marketing.
Vehicle Wraps: Mobile Billboards for Your Business
Turn your vans into moving ads with professional wraps. They make your business seen everywhere:
- Get 30,000-70,000 daily views while driving
- Make your brand known in local spots
- It’s a smart, one-time ad investment
Make your wrap stand out with clear, professional graphics. Include:
- Your business name that’s easy to read
- Your phone number clearly
- Your website URL
- A catchy slogan (like “24/7 Emergency Service”)
Direct Mail: Targeted Local Marketing
Direct mail is great for reaching people in certain areas. Focus on places with older homes or high-income areas. These places might need plumbing services more.
Make your direct mail pop by:
- Offering special deals
- Setting clear deadlines
- Showing off your work with before-and-after pics
- Highlighting your unique guarantees
Use special promo codes or phone numbers to see how well your ads do. This way, you can see if your traditional ads are worth it in your plumbing marketing.
Measuring Your Advertising ROI and Performance Metrics
To effectively advertise your plumbing business, you need to focus on data. It’s key to track the right metrics. This helps you decide where to spend your ad budget and get the best return.
Successful plumbing businesses don’t just throw money at ads. They analyze every dollar to make sure it works. When learning to advertise your plumbing business, focus on important metrics that give you useful insights.
Essential Key Performance Indicators to Track
- Total leads generated from all advertising channels
- Cost per lead for each marketing method
- Lead-to-customer conversion rate
- Customer acquisition cost
- Average job value
- Return on ad spend
To really get how well your ads work, you need to look closely at your data. Tracking leads by source is key to finding the best channels.
Tools for Monitoring Campaign Performance
| Tool | Primary Function | Key Benefit |
|---|---|---|
| Google Analytics | Website Traffic Analysis | Comprehensive visitor tracking |
| CallRail | Call Tracking | Source attribution for phone leads |
| Google Search Console | Organic Search Performance | Keyword ranking insights |
Wait at least 30 days before changing your ad strategy. Increase budgets for channels that bring in profitable leads. Keep improving your strategy with solid data.
Your aim is to build a marketing system that always brings in quality leads and keeps costs low. By using these tracking tools, you’ll move from guessing to growing your business smartly.
